Subject: Partner SFTP drop — new owner

Hi,

As you review the pending changes to the Harborline ingest scripts, note that ownership of the partner SFTP drop is changing at the end of the month. This includes key rotation, the nightly pull job, and the quarantine folder for malformed files. Review comments on the retry logic should still go through the normal PR flow, but questions about drop-folder conventions or partner onboarding now go to the new owner. The incoming owner is listed below.

signatory, tagaf-bahaf: Praael Fenmir Rusok

## Changelog — v4.8.2: changed defaults after session-token refresh bug

We discovered that Lanternbridge's auth sidecar refreshed session tokens only after expiry, causing a brief window of rejected requests under load. The refresh lead time and retry defaults have been changed accordingly, and the old values are intentionally no longer honored. Future maintainers should not revert these without reading incident review LB-Spring. The new default configuration shipped with this release follows.

config for yajep-tafof:
[rusath]
team = julmir
access_code = ac_fe37fd
host = rusath.novactech.test
port = 8000
owner = pelmir.weneth
peer = oliwyn.olvarqdyn.internal

**Changelog 4.8.2 — Datefmt key rotation**

Rotated the signing key for the Kalendra locale packs after the scheduled expiry. Date-format bundles (short/long forms, week-start rules) for all 31 locales were re-signed and republished. Support: if a customer reports "untrusted locale pack" errors, have them clear the pack cache and verify against the new key below.

deploy key for kajof-fajop: bky6_gDHw9Q